The world is changing fast, with artificial intelligence (AI) becoming a bigger part of our daily lives. Statista predicts that by 2025, the global AI market will be worth over $300 billion, showcasing its rapid growth and impact. As we embrace this technology, understanding AI agents is key to grasping their potential.
AI agents are systems that can perform tasks independently. They analyze data, make decisions, and learn from their experiences. The shift toward agentic AI signifies a move toward more autonomous systems that can transform industries and lives.

Core Capabilities of AI Agents
Key traits of AI agents include:
- Autonomy: They operate independently without constant human oversight.
- Goal-Oriented Behavior: They can set and pursue specific objectives.
- Environmental Interaction: They sense and respond to changes in their surroundings.
- Learning Capabilities: They improve their performance over time through experience.
Types of AI Agents
AI agents can be categorized based on their functionalities:
- Simple Reflex Agents: Execute actions based on current input.
- Model-Based Agents: Maintain an internal model of the world to inform decisions.
- Utility-Based Agents: Assess options based on a defined set of goals to maximize benefits.
The Rise of Agentic AI: Key Drivers and Trends
Increased Computing Power and Data Availability
Technological advancements have exponentially increased computing power and data access. According to the International Data Corporation, the global data sphere is expected to grow to 175 zettabytes by 2025. With more data available, AI agents can analyze patterns more effectively, resulting in better tools and applications.
Advancements in Machine Learning Algorithms
Recent breakthroughs in machine learning have propelled agentic AI forward. Key developments include:
- Reinforcement Learning: Allows agents to learn optimal actions through trial and error.
- Deep Learning: Uses neural networks to process vast amounts of data quickly.
These innovations enable agents to adapt and make smarter decisions, expanding their potential applications.
Growing Demand for Automation and Efficiency
The drive for increased automation has led many industries to adopt AI agents. Examples of sectors benefiting include:
- Manufacturing: AI agents optimize production lines and reduce downtime.
- Finance: Agents detect fraud and automate trading, increasing efficiency.
- Healthcare: AI improves diagnostics and streamlines patient care.
The accelerating need for efficiency positions agentic AI as a valuable resource.
Real-World Applications of AI Agents: Examples and Case Studies
AI Agents in Customer Service
AI-powered chatbots, such as those used by companies like Amazon and Sephora, enhance customer experiences. Research shows that businesses using chatbots experience up to a 30% increase in customer satisfaction and a significant reduction in response times.
AI Agents in Robotics and Automation
Autonomous robots are revolutionizing logistics and manufacturing. Companies like Amazon deploy robots in warehouses to manage inventory and fulfill orders quickly. This automation has led to a 20% increase in operational efficiency for some firms.
AI Agents in Healthcare
AI agents are changing the healthcare landscape. Agents like IBM Watson analyze medical data for faster diagnoses and personalized treatment plans. These systems have shown to improve accuracy and patient outcomes, significantly impacting healthcare delivery.
The Future of Agentic AI: Challenges and Opportunities
Ethical Considerations and Bias Mitigation
As AI agents grow, ethical concerns arise. Issues such as bias in decision-making and accountability must be addressed. Ensuring fairness and transparency in AI systems is essential to gaining public trust.
Addressing Security and Safety Concerns
AI agents also raise security concerns. Malicious use or unintended consequences can pose risks. Establishing robust security protocols is crucial to protect systems and users from harm.
The Potential for Transformative Impact
Despite challenges, agentic AI holds vast potential. It can enhance productivity, improve quality of life, and drive economic growth across various sectors. Embracing this technology could lead to significant societal changes.
